On the expansion coefficients of Tau-functions of the KP hierarchy. (English) Zbl 1508.37091

Summary: We study the coefficients of the tau function of the KP hierarchy. If the tau function does not vanish at the origin, it is known that the coefficients are given by Giambelli formula. We introduce a generalization of Giambelli formula to the case when the tau function vanishes at the origin. This paper is a summary of [A. Nakayashiki et al., J. Integrable Syst. 2, Article ID xyx007, 23 p. (2017; Zbl 1397.37076)].
